Go now, gather the threads of hatred, prejudice, and oppression then cut them loose,
Empty their remains into the gaping maw of the ocean,
Over the earth as waves rise up together
Resisting the touch of demons who lure the eyes toward blindness, who lull toward slumber
Go now, be the voice of righteous opposition and sing awake,
“Enough is enough! History will not repeat itself!”
Feel the rythym of many drums beating as one, feel the wings of angels who walk among you,
Listen from your heart,
Only then will you know
You are me and I am you
Despite the difference in the colour of our skin, we are, have been, and will be human kin
In kinship let us birth a world where
We matter to one another where
Power is stitched from the same threads that
Embroider mercy and compassion.
